IN RE BENNETT

No. 13112.

13 F.Supp. 353 (1936)

In re BENNETT.

District Court, W. D. Missouri, W. D.

January 24, 1936.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

B. C. Howard, of Kansas City, Mo., for lienholders.

McClintock & Quant, of Kansas City, Mo., for debtor.


OTIS, District Judge.

The debtor seeks the relief provided in subsection (s) of section 75 of the Act of Congress relating to bankruptcy as amended August 28, 1935, 49 Stat. 942, 943, § 6, 11 U.S.C.A. § 203 (s). A secured creditor of the debtor moves for a dismissal of the petition on the sole ground that the act of Congress referred to is unconstitutional.
